RAV4Driver
This review updates a one month prior entry. Now that I 've fished it a bit more, AWESOME rod. I 've just bought a second. Originally for panfish and trout, it's become my favorite for accurate presentations wading bulrush shorelines for bass on inland and Great Lakes. Fast action to telegraph every bit of the action, with enough spine to steer the big guys away from trouble. Paired with a Pflueger President 20 or 25 reel, the combo is light, comfortable, and tough enough to fish all day. I run 4# Sufix with an 18 '' Vanish Fluoro leader on Carolina or Neko rigs. Precise casting, and even with this light tackle, have n't felt undergunned on big Largemouths or Smallmouths. It's just a blast to take 'em on with this rod.

RAV4Driver
Bought this 7' one piece medium action/fast rod as an upgrade for panfish and trout. In the last 3 weeks, I 've taken 11 nice 2 plus lb bass along with plenty of large panfish. Very sensitive for finesse presentations, and the fast action means fun battles with plenty of spine when needed to keep the big guys from brush piles. I 've paired with a Pflueger President size 20 reel and Berkley Sufix or Trilene XT 4 lb line with a 6# Flourocarbon leader. Casting is wonderful, controlled, predictable and accurate with the lighter line and rigs near the 1/8 minimum for this rod. Only takeaway is the reel mount, which places your fingers on the base of the spinning reel with no cork or EVA under. Gets a bit uncomfortable after a few hours compared to my Berkley or Fenwick predecessors, and just would be unbearable for cold temperature Spring or late Fall fishing.

jiggingMatt
TRIS70MF 7' 0 ''( Fast Medium) has created a relationship with Pampano that I did not think possible. I fish the Tampa Bay, Florida region. I have caught Bonnet Head Sharks, 16 '' Pampano to the fork, 15 ''( to the fork) Jack Cervell, 25 '' Snook, and 6 other species. I jig off the bottom of sand bars, jetties, and piers. I can feel it when a Pampano grabs the lure, sucks it in, sits still, and grinds it like it would with a shrimp/sand flea. I can feel this relationship with this pole. The sensitivity, the weight, and when it needs the stiffness of a Medium to work a snook or crazy Jack Cervelle this pole delivers. I run a pole that is under a pound. When the entire group is catching nothing I can bring in 2 to 6 fish and have the entire pier trying to understand. My entire system: St. Croix TRIS70MF, Shimano Miravel Spinning Reel 4000, 30lb green super braid by Yo- Zuri, Yo- Zuri pink 30lb leader, and a 1/2 oz pink vertical jig( pink for pampano) that looks like a shrimp.
